Bolma pseudobathyraphis is a species of sea snail, a marine gastropod mollusk in the family Turbinidae, the turban snails.[2][3]

Description

The size of the shell varies between 28 mm and 42 mm.

Distribution

This marine species was found off the Norfolk Ridge, New Caledonia
